COLLEGE CLASSES COLLEGE JUNIOR CLASS Memories of Christian fellowship and activity in regular class meetings, socials, :Ind Ill'05.El'!llllS will linger in years to come, llnder the capable and efficient Sponsorship of Bro. Chester K. Lehman. we were led to a more intimate relationship with our Mas- ter. Highlights of the year were the evening: at i'Brother Chester's home, the class social, and the annual .Iunior-Senior outing. Of the thirty-two members of the class, three discontinued their studies ai' the conclusion of the first Semester because of the draft. XVQ: are looking: i'orwarrl with much anticipation to graduation in the new l'llfllN'l-Rlllflll'O1'll1ll'l in lil-14. COLLEGE BIBLE STUDENTS Tn the College Bible course. Eastern Mennonite School provides a curriculum that gives training to those who wish lo study the Bible thoroughly. The faculty, in its teaching. aims to keep several important points always in the fore. First, to have each student' give his heart fo Christ: second. to have each isltudeut i11doct1'i11:1ted in the belief of the Mennonite Church: third. to impress each student with the fact that he needs to be consecrated wholly to God for sei-viceg last, to give each student advice thai' will enable him to iind his place in God's plan for the salvation of lost humanity. l A , L llll
